## Local Setup: EXIF Scrubbing Service

The Pixelwane scrub service strips EXIF metadata from uploads before storage. Clone the repo, install dependencies with `make deps`, and start the worker with `make run-scrubber`. Processed images are logged to the `scrub_audit` table so we can prove metadata removal. Sample images for testing live in `fixtures/raw`. The worker needs a database to record audit rows; point it at the dev instance using the connection string below.

replica DSN, kajep-yahag: mssql://praok_svc:iF@db-8d68.plorvaio.local:5432/eliion

Quick note on the interview suite: Room 2.08 at Verilane House is our secure space for candidate interviews, so please keep it tidy and don't let visitors wander in unescorted. Candidates wait in the lobby until their interviewer collects them. If you need to open the room to set up water and notepads, use the staff code below.

turnstile pass: bdg-PD-2

ALERT: catalog-cache-stale

Fires when Pruneberry catalog cache entries exceed their invalidation SLA by 15 minutes. Symptom: shoppers see outdated prices or delisted items on storefronts. Likely causes: stuck invalidation consumer, burst of bulk edits from merchandising, or Redquill queue backlog. Support: confirm with the cache-lag dashboard, then advise merchants that edits will propagate once the backlog drains. Do not purge the cache yourself. If the alert persists past 30 minutes, escalate by mail.

escalation mailbox, bafog-fafog: ulador@paliqlabs.internal

## Step 6: Digest Scheduler

Reviewer: confirm the Pellworth digest scheduler config before approving. Batch window is 02:00–04:00 local per region; overlapping windows will double-send. Check that the cron expression matches the tenant table and that retry backoff caps at three attempts. Dry-run output must show zero duplicate recipient sets. Reject any change that alters the dedupe hash without a migration note. Once checks pass, sign the deploy manifest with the key below.

rollout seal: bky4_x7Gc